Output 313ca56ee6a0ce25c79c1fd20c81e26517057187fe28a0a98d2f7a9189dfec2b:2

value
429560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d0604eb02184bfd948d1a08d501d27fc0f030fe OP_EQUAL
address
3MqgUAFncrW6bFDXcLCNB9nJUjdapY6DL4
transaction
313ca56ee6a0ce25c79c1fd20c81e26517057187fe28a0a98d2f7a9189dfec2b
spent
true